Technical Specifications NC7MXX

General Information

Features

  • Connector(s)
    XLR
  • Product color
    Aluminum, Black
  • AWG wire sizes
    18
  • Contacts of the plating connector
    Silver/Nickel
  • International Protection Code (IP)
    IP40
  • Heart size
    1 mm²
  • Electric force
    1500 V
  • Contact resistance
    3 mΩ
  • Capacitance between the contacts
    9 pF
  • Lifespan (cycles)
    1000
  • Tension
    50 V
  • Current
    5 A
  • Hull armor
    Nickel
  • Locking element material
    Zinc
  • Locking element material
    Zinc
  • Withdrawal force
    20 N (1 kilogram-force = 9.81 Newton)
  • Withdrawal force
    20 N (1 kilogram-force = 9.81 Newton)

Packaging information

  • Quantity
    1 piece(s)

Environmental conditions

  • Operating temperature
    -30 - 80 °C

Weight and dimensions

  • Outer diameter
    8 mm

Features

The Neutrik NC7MXX features a composite connector, ensuring effective connectivity suitable for various uses. Its black aluminum finish gives it a modern and elegant aesthetic. This product is compatible with AWG wires of size 18, providing application flexibility. The connector contacts, plated with silver and nickel, ensure a reliable and durable connection.

This model has an IP40 protection rating, indicating protection against solid bodies and limited resistance to moisture. The core size is 1 mm², ensuring adequate electrical performance. Its dielectric strength is impressive, reaching 1500 V, while the contact resistance is measured at 3 mΩ, ensuring optimal performance in electronic applications.

With a capacitance of 9 pF between contacts, the Neutrik NC7MXX is designed for prolonged use, with a lifespan in cycles of 1000. The operating voltage is 50 V and the supported current is 5 A, thus ensuring safe and efficient use. The zinc housing offers enhanced durability, while the nickel shielding protects against impacts and scratches. Its insertion and withdrawal force is 20 N, ensuring easy handling while maintaining a secure connection.
